A director’s or personal ensure is a commitment to pay back a loan that is general in nature rather than specifying the security for a particular asset. The person signing the guarantee is personally responsible if the business the borrower fails to make the repayment.

The Personal Property Securities Register (PPSR) is an online central register run by the New Zealand Government. It reflects security interests which are registered with respect to personal property (including items or assets). The PPSR gives the priority of personal property assigned in accordance with the date on which a security interest was registered.

A caveat is a legal document lodged to offer notice of a legal claim to a property.

About business loans

What’s an asset-based borrow (a secured loan)?

Asset-based borrowing is when the business owner makes use of an asset that they own to secure a loan. The asset can be an asset belonging to the personal, like the family home or it could be a company asset such as a truck or piece or equipment.

The majority of lending institutions, not just the banks with the biggest size, prefer to guarantee loans against an asset. If you’re having trouble paying back the loan, your assets could be transferred to the lender. In essence it is an opportunity to secure new funding making use of the value of what you already own.
